The free-to-play “StarCraft MMO,” StarCraft Universe, being made with Blizzard’s approval—surpassed its $80,000 funding goal on Kickstarter with a day left in the campaign. A five-player boss raid demo (that’s the video) released in the last week of the drive is credited with pushing the team over the top.

In Japan, the Vita is Getting a Brand New 64GB Memory Card
Today, Sony announced a new 64GB model for their line of PlayStation Vita SD cards. The 64GB model will retail at a price of 10,479 yen—roughly $105.
